Why Daily Vlogs Have Us Addicted: A Deep Dive

 


Daily vlogs have taken YouTube by storm in the digital content creation world. Vlogging, a blend of "video" and "blogging," has transformed how we share our lives and connect with others in the digital age. This unique storytelling medium emerged in the early 2000s, gaining traction with platforms like YouTube, where creators showcased their lives, thoughts, and adventures through engaging videos. From modest origins, vlogging has evolved into a cultural phenomenon, with millions of creators documenting everything from daily routines to extravagant travels.

Daily vlogs have a distinct way of interacting with audiences, combining fun, truthfulness, and habits that make them difficult to turn away from. What makes vlogging so captivating is its power to create a connection between the creator and the audience. Viewers are not just passive observers; they become part of a shared experience, witnessing the highs and lows of someone else's life. This authenticity fosters relatability and trust, allowing audiences to form emotional bonds with their favorite vloggers.

But what makes daily vlogs particularly addictive? First and foremost, the relatability of the content plays a significant role. Viewers connect emotionally with vloggers as they witness their everyday lives. This transparency helps the audience feel like they are a part of the vlogger's inner circle, blurring the distinction between creator and viewer. Watching a vlog, like any other habit, can become a part of our everyday routine. It's simple to become addicted when fresh content is released daily, giving a consistent source of entertainment that fits into our schedules.

The allure of para-social relationships—where viewers feel a one-sided bond with vloggers—further contributes to this phenomenon. These are one-way interactions in which the viewer develops a strong bond with the vlogger even though the vlogger does not know them personally. Coupled with FOMO (Fear of Missing Out), it drives individuals to keep watching, ensuring they never miss a moment.

The excitement of new content uploads delivers a dopamine hit and missing an episode of your favorite vlog might seem like missing out on a significant event in a friend's life. This physiological reaction enhances the viewing experience and makes vlogs something viewers eagerly anticipate. Over time, this creates a cycle in which the viewer becomes addicted to the emotions associated with new information from their favorite vlogger.
